Ugandan parliamentarians in 2014 gained sixty moments what was gained by most condition personnel, and so they sought A significant improve. This caused popular criticism and protests, such as the smuggling of two piglets in the parliament in June 2014 to spotlight corruption amongst users of parliament. The protesters, who were being arrested, employed the word "MPigs" to highlight their grievance.[88]
Considering that its independence from Britain in 1962, the east African country has viewed a number of coups, accompanied by Idi Amin's brutal armed service dictatorship within the 1970s, followed by a five-year war that brought present President Yoweri Museveni to energy in 1986.
Political parties in Uganda had been limited inside their pursuits starting that 12 months, in a evaluate ostensibly designed to cut down sectarian violence. While in the non-party "Movement" program instituted by Museveni, political parties continued to exist, but they could run only a headquarters Place of work.

On twenty February 2011, the Uganda Electoral Fee declared the incumbent president Yoweri Kaguta Museveni the winning prospect with the 2011 elections that were held on eighteen February 2011. The opposition nevertheless, weren't pleased with the results, condemning them as stuffed with sham and rigging. According to the Formal effects, Museveni won with sixty eight percent of your votes. This simply topped his closest challenger, Besigye, who were Museveni's health practitioner and told reporters that he and his supporters "downrightly snub" the result together with the unremitting rule of Museveni or any person he may well appoint.

Most inter-town transportation in Uganda is by smaller van or big bus. Quite a few motorists of these cars have minimal training, and some are reckless. Smaller vans and large buses tend to be improperly taken care of, travel at superior speeds, and they are the principal automobiles involved with the numerous lethal solitary and multi-automobile mishaps alongside Ugandan streets. Accident victims have involved U.S. citizens touring in little vans and private automobiles, travellers on motorcycle taxis locally generally known as "boda bodas" (see Crime earlier mentioned), and pedestrians. Massive trucks within the highways will often be overloaded, with inadequately secured cargo and weak braking devices. Alcohol frequently is a contributing Think about street accidents, especially during the night.
